快速连接Oracle数据库:R语言实现方案(r连接oracle数据库)

Oracle数据库的快速链接是开发人员和企业每天所面临的考验之一。有许多方法可以用来实现快速连接Oracle数据库,其中最流行的是用R语言,在本文中我们将讨论一下快速连接Oracle数据库的R语言实现方案。

首先,使用R语言连接Oracle数据库,需要在R Studio中安装oracle和RODBC两个包。要安装这两个包,可以在R Studio中使用install.packages命令进行安装:

install.packages("oracle")
install.packages("RODBC")

接下来,需要打开Oracle数据库的链接。为此,需要在R环境中设置Oracle的用户名和密码,可以通过设置Sys.setenv函数来实现。

Sys.setenv(ORACLE_USERNAME = "username")
Sys.setenv(ORACLE_PASSWORD = "password")

有了用户名和密码之后,R环境就可以构建链接到Oracle数据库,可以使用odbcConnect函数

odbcConnect("oracle", UID="username", PWD="password")

接下来,就可以运行SQL查询语句,以R语言的形式返回结果,比如sqlQuery函数:

results 

在这个函数里,results变量将会是存储查询结果的数据框格式。

由于R语言比较简洁,上述步骤可以使用一句简单的指令就可以实现:

results 
connection=odbcConnect("oracle",
UID="username", PWD="password"))

看到这里,我们可以得出结论:使用R语言来快速连接Oracle数据库是一种非常有效的解决方案。它提供了简洁易用的函数,可以极大地降低开发时间,有效提高开发效率,更加方便快捷。


数据运维技术 » 快速连接Oracle数据库:R语言实现方案(r连接oracle数据库)